The Role of a Property Manager in Tenant Screening and Selection

Tenant screening is one of the most critical functions of a property manager, as it directly impacts the quality of tenants you attract and the overall success of your rental business. A professional property manager employs rigorous screening processes that include background checks, credit evaluations, and rental history assessments. This thorough approach helps identify reliable tenants who are likely to pay rent on time and take care of your property.

Additionally, an experienced property manager understands the importance of finding tenants who align with your expectations as a landlord. They take the time to interview potential tenants and assess their suitability for your specific rental criteria. By ensuring that only qualified individuals are selected, they minimize the risk of problematic tenancies and create a more harmonious living environment for everyone involved.

The Legal and Regulatory Responsibilities of Property Managers

Property management involves navigating a complex landscape of legal obligations and regulations that vary by location. A professional property manager is well-acquainted with these laws, including the Residential Tenancy Act 1987 in Western Australia. Their expertise ensures that all aspects of managing your rental property comply with legal requirements, protecting you from potential liabilities.

By adhering strictly to legal guidelines, professional managers safeguard both landlords and tenants from misunderstandings or disputes that could arise from non-compliance. This commitment to legality not only fosters trust between parties but also contributes to smoother operations overall. With a knowledgeable property manager at the helm, you can rest assured that your investment is being managed responsibly and ethically.
